    TOP Exclusive: William 'Barney' Watson interview. (Video)

    Ladies and Gentlemen, as a precursor of things to come in the near future, we are proud to present our new Youtube channel, along with our first video interview:

    Former Special Forces Non Commissioned Officer, William 'Barney' Watson, recounts the details of his military career and personnel experience with the Alien Abduction phenomenon in this exclusive interview with OutPost Forum Co-Owner, Chris Iversen.



    Special thanks go to Kent Hendrick and Addison Wright for video production work!
